The Social Security Administration administers federal social insurance programs. It manages Social Security, providing retirement, disability and survivor benefits to eligible individuals. The agency offers claims processing and benefit distribution.

I am a retired CPA and my wife is a retired teacher. We started receiving our retirement benefits from Social Security in January of 2013. Since we both were on Parts A & B of Medicare prior to receiving retirement benefits, we were required to remit our Part B Medicare premiums in 2012 (which are now generally $104.90) 3 months in advance. If they weren't paid in advance, Medicare would have cancelled our insurance coverage, so payment in advance was mandatory.
When we started collecting our retirement benefits, we were told that it was also mandatory for Social Security to deduct the monthly Medicare premium from our retirement benefits which are generally paid within the first 2 or 3 weeks of the month subsequent to the month they are paying you for (you receive Jan. benefit in Feb. and Feb. in Mar. and so on). Upon receiving our benefits, we realized that they had deducted Medicare premiums for months which had already been paid for by us directly through checks we remitted. In effect, we had paid two premiums for the same month.
We notified Social Security who informed us that this was an issue that had to be taken up with Medicare. Of course when we called Medicare, they tried to send us back to Social Security insisting this was a matter that we had to take up with their office. By now, I was furious and absolutely refused to get off the phone and call Social Security again and so they "escalated" my case promising me a callback within 48 hrs which was never made. I had to call them again and explain the whole problem to yet another agent who promised another callback.
When I finally spoke to the "escalation" department, they informed me that they did not owe us anything since the payments that they receive from Social Security are credited to my account the month after they are deducted. So, the bottom line is that my wife and I and every other one of the millions of people that have started their Medicare Part B coverage prior to starting their retirement benefits are out of pocket for one month of premiums, generally $104.90.
Since the normal age for starting Medicare coverage is generally 65 and the normal retirement age is generally 66 or 67 depending upon your year of birth, this injustice is being perpetrated on many, many recipients and the Social Security and Medicare agencies are holding millions of dollars of our senior citizens' monies unjustly. Social Security and Medicare are effectively cheating its senior citizens out of one month's Medicare premium indefinitely. This practice is an outrage and should be stopped immediately!
